Executive Summary This report explores trends in Battery Storage capacity additions and describes the current state of the Market , including information on applications, cost, and Market and policy drivers.

10 There are a number of key takeaways: At the end of 2017, 708 megawatts (MW) of power capacity, 1 representing 867 megawatthours (MWh) of energy capacity, 2 of large-scale 3 Battery Storage capacity was in operation. Over 80% of large-scale Battery Storage power capacity is currently provided by batteries based on lithium-ion chemistries. About 90% of large-scale Battery Storage in the United States is installed in regions covered by five of the seven organized independent system operators (ISOs) or regional transmission organizations (RTOs) and in Alaska and Hawaii (AK/HI).
